- The Salvation Army, an international movement, is an evangelical part of the universal Christian Church.
- Its ministry is motivated by the love of God. Its mission is to preach the gospel of Jesus Christ and to meet human needs in His name without discrimination.
- We are the largest non-governmental provider of social services in America and every year, we help over 30 million Americans overcome poverty, homelessness, addiction, economic hardships, loneliness, and exploitation through a wide range of programs and services.
- The Territorial Social Services Director (TSSD) will advance and sustain the integrated Christian ministry of The Salvation Army through its mission to preach the gospel of Jesus Christ and to meet human needs in His name without discrimination, by articulating, encouraging, and promoting the values of The Army as delivered through Social Services programs and ministries.
- Ensure the understanding and commitment of all Salvation Army social service programs, including those accredited by external agencies, to develop and implement a pastoral care plan to meet the spiritual needs of program participants.
